How To Fix C$839 - .... Component info: Component: &1 /(direct: &2) /component type: &3


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: C$ -

  • Message number: 839

  • Message text: .... Component info: Component: &1 /(direct: &2) /component type: &3

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message C$839 - .... Component info: Component: &1 /(direct: &2) /component type: &3 ?

    The SAP error message C$839 typically indicates an issue related to the component information in the system. The message format suggests that it is related to a specific component, which is identified by the placeholders &1, &2, and &3. These placeholders usually represent:

    • &1: The name of the component.
    • &2: The direct reference or identifier for the component.
    • &3: The type of the component.

    Possible Causes:

    1. Missing Component: The specified component may not be installed or activated in the system.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be incorrect configuration settings related to the component.
    3. Version Mismatch: The component version may not be compatible with the current version of the SAP system.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access or use the component.
    5. Transport Issues: If the component was recently transported, there may have been issues during the transport process.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Component Installation: Verify that the component is installed and activated in the SAP system. You can do this by checking the system's component list.
    2. Review Configuration: Ensure that the configuration settings for the component are correct. This may involve checking transaction codes related to the component.
    3. Compatibility Check: Confirm that the component version is compatible with your SAP system version. If not, consider upgrading or downgrading the component.
    4.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the component. This may involve checking user roles and profiles.
    5. Transport Logs: If the component was recently transported, check the transport logs for any errors or warnings that may indicate issues during the transport process.
